Obrázek může být reprezentace.
Viz Specifikace pro podrobnosti o produktu.
MSP430F5244IRGZR

MSP430F5244IRGZR

Product Overview

Category

The MSP430F5244IRGZR belongs to the category of microcontrollers.

Use

This microcontroller is designed for various embedded applications that require low power consumption and high performance.

Characteristics

  • Low power consumption: The MSP430F5244IRGZR is known for its ultra-low power consumption, making it suitable for battery-powered devices.
  • High performance: Despite its low power consumption, this microcontroller offers high processing capabilities, enabling efficient execution of complex tasks.
  • Integrated peripherals: It comes with a wide range of integrated peripherals such as timers, UART, SPI, I2C, and ADC, providing flexibility in designing different applications.
  • Real-time clock (RTC): The microcontroller includes an accurate RTC module, allowing precise timekeeping functionality.
  • Extended temperature range: With an extended operating temperature range, the MSP430F5244IRGZR can be used in harsh environments.

Package

The MSP430F5244IRGZR is available in a small form factor package, specifically the 64-pin VQFN package.

Essence

The essence of the MSP430F5244IRGZR lies in its ability to provide a balance between low power consumption and high performance, making it ideal for energy-efficient applications.

Packaging/Quantity

This microcontroller is typically sold in reels or trays, with a quantity of 2500 units per reel/tray.

Specifications

  • Architecture: 16-bit RISC
  • CPU Speed: Up to 25 MHz
  • Flash Memory: 128 KB
  • RAM: 8 KB
  • Operating Voltage Range: 1.8V - 3.6V
  • Digital I/O Pins: 48
  • Analog Input Channels: 16
  • Communication Interfaces: UART, SPI, I2C
  • Timers: 4x 16-bit timers
  • ADC Resolution: 12-bit
  •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The MSP430F5244IRGZR has a total of 64 pins. The pin configuration is as follows:

  • P1.x: Digital I/O pins (x = 0 to 7)
  • P2.x: Digital I/O pins (x = 0 to 7)
  • P3.x: Digital I/O pins (x = 0 to 7)
  • P4.x: Digital I/O pins (x = 0 to 7)
  • P5.x: Digital I/O pins (x = 0 to 7)
  • P6.x: Digital I/O pins (x = 0 to 7)
  • P7.x: Digital I/O pins (x = 0 to 7)
  • P8.x: Digital I/O pins (x = 0 to 7)
  • P9.x: Digital I/O pins (x = 0 to 7)
  • P10.x: Digital I/O pins (x = 0 to 7)
  • A0-A15: Analog input channels
  • RST: Reset pin
  • TEST: Test mode pin
  • DVCC: Digital power supply
  • AVCC: Analog power supply
  • GND: Ground

Functional Features

Low Power Modes

The MSP430F5244IRGZR offers various low power modes, including standby and sleep modes, allowing the microcontroller to conserve energy when not actively processing tasks.

Integrated Peripherals

This microcontroller includes a wide range of integrated peripherals such as UART, SPI, I2C, and ADC. These peripherals enhance the functionality and flexibility of the microcontroller, enabling seamless integration with external devices.

Real-Time Clock (RTC)

The MSP430F5244IRGZR features an accurate RTC module, which enables precise timekeeping functionality. This is particularly useful in applications that require time-sensitive operations or scheduling.

Enhanced Security

To ensure data integrity and protection, the microcontroller incorporates security features such as memory protection and encryption algorithms, safeguarding sensitive information.

Advantages

  • Ultra-low power consumption extends battery life in portable devices.
  • High-performance capabilities enable efficient execution of complex tasks.
  • Integrated peripherals provide flexibility in designing various applications.
  • Accurate real-time clock module facilitates time-sensitive operations.
  • Extended temperature range allows usage in harsh environments.

Disadvantages

  • Limited flash memory capacity compared to some other microcontrollers in the same category.
  • Higher cost compared to lower-end microcontrollers with similar specifications.

Working Principles

The MSP430F5244IRGZR operates on a 16-bit RISC architecture. It executes instructions fetched from its flash memory using a pipeline architecture, enabling efficient processing. The microcontroller communicates with external devices through its integrated peripherals, allowing data exchange and control.

Detailed Application Field Plans

The MSP430F5244IRGZR finds applications in

Seznam 10 běžných otázek a odpovědí souvisejících s aplikací MSP430F5244IRGZR v technických řešeních

Sure! Here are 10 common questions and answers related to the application of MSP430F5244IRGZR in technical solutions:

  1. Q: What is MSP430F5244IRGZR? A: MSP430F5244IRGZR is a microcontroller from Texas Instruments' MSP430 family, specifically designed for embedded applications.

  2. Q: What are the key features of MSP430F5244IRGZR? A: Some key features include a 16-bit RISC architecture, low power consumption, integrated peripherals, and a wide operating voltage range.

  3. Q: What are the typical applications of MSP430F5244IRGZR? A: MSP430F5244IRGZR is commonly used in applications such as industrial control systems, home automation, portable medical devices, and sensor networks.

  4. Q: How does MSP430F5244IRGZR achieve low power consumption? A: The microcontroller incorporates various power-saving modes, such as standby mode, sleep mode, and low-power oscillator options, which help reduce power consumption.

  5. Q: Can I interface external devices with MSP430F5244IRGZR? A: Yes, MSP430F5244IRGZR provides multiple communication interfaces like UART, SPI, and I2C, allowing you to easily connect and communicate with external devices.

  6. Q: Is MSP430F5244IRGZR suitable for battery-powered applications? A: Yes, MSP430F5244IRGZR is well-suited for battery-powered applications due to its low power consumption and efficient power management capabilities.

  7. Q: What programming language can be used with MSP430F5244IRGZR? A: MSP430F5244IRGZR can be programmed using C or assembly language. Texas Instruments provides a comprehensive development environment called Code Composer Studio for programming and debugging.

  8. Q: Can I update the firmware of MSP430F5244IRGZR in the field? A: Yes, MSP430F5244IRGZR supports in-system programming (ISP), allowing you to update the firmware in the field without removing the microcontroller from the system.

  9. Q: Does MSP430F5244IRGZR have built-in analog-to-digital converters (ADC)? A: Yes, MSP430F5244IRGZR has a built-in 12-bit ADC, which can be used to convert analog signals into digital values for further processing.

  10. Q: Are there any development boards or evaluation kits available for MSP430F5244IRGZR? A: Yes, Texas Instruments offers various development boards and evaluation kits specifically designed for MSP430 microcontrollers, including MSP-EXP430F5529LP and MSP-EXP430FR5994. These kits provide a convenient platform for prototyping and testing MSP430F5244IRGZR-based solutions.

Please note that the specific details and features may vary depending on the version and revision of the microcontroller. It's always recommended to refer to the official documentation and datasheet for accurate and up-to-date information.